DE BRUIGNAC, Alb. Duroy. Satan et La Magie de Nos Jours; Reflexions Pratiques sur le Magnetisme, le Spiritisime et la Magie.

Paris: Librairie de Ch. Bleriot, 1864. 9" x 5.75", xi + 218pp. Softcover with cloth spine and printed wraps. Rear cover missing a corner and with a narrow, diagonal stain (as pictured). Persistent dampstain internally along upper right corner but remains in margin and doesn't affect text. Foxing noted throughout. Good+.

A moral and theological critique of mid-19th-century occultism, “Satan et la magie de nos jours” warns that mesmerism, spiritism, and modern “scientific” magic are veiled forms of demonic influence. Duroy de Bruignac surveys the history of magic and the supernatural, arguing that contemporary fascination with unseen forces imperils both faith and reason. Written at the height of Europe’s spiritualist movement, the work reflects Catholic anxiety over the rise of modern occult science and psychology.
